Did I intend to open this book and then proceed to read the entire thing in one sitting? No, BUT THEN I DID!

Hunt was another fantastic installment in the highly underrated North series. It’s incredibly easy to be sucked into the detailed worldbuilding and the fast-paced plot. The characters have gone on such amazing journeys so far and this book expanded the world even more! Plus, the romance reached a whole new level— SLOOOOOOOW BURN ENEMIES TO LOVERS, never misses!!! I loved seeing how Apaay grappled with the many major revelations which burdened her new responsibilities and powers and I’m looking forward to seeing how she moves forward. It’s exciting to continue peeling back the layers behind the Face Stealer’s past, even though I wanted to slap him for a majority of this because he just CANT STOP KEEPING SECRETS!! Numiak, WHY. And Ila really flourished in her new role and identity and I can’t wait to see her grow further. The ending was shockingly meannnn but it definitely sets up the next book to be a wild ride!

If you haven’t taken a chance on this series yet, it’s available for free on Kindle Unlimited and I really recommend it! It’s full of enemies to lovers goodness, shapeshifters, charming demons, slow burn romances, incredible friendships and an entertaining plot—check it out ASAP!
